A Tale of Two Worlds
Echoes reintroduces players to bounty hunter Samus Aran, this time dispatched on the mysterious World Aether to investigate the disappearance of a Galactic Federation squad. What starts as a reconnaissance mission immediately unravels into a battle against a powerful, corrupting power referred to as Darkish Aether — a twisted mirror Variation of the principle environment. This dual-globe mechanic gets to be central to the game’s design and narrative.

Navigating in between Light-weight and Dim Aether provides a prosperous layer of strategic complexity. Players must regulate health and fitness though Discovering the toxic ambiance of Darkish Aether, relying on safe zones to outlive. This duality generates a compelling force-pull dynamic, forcing gamers to balance hazard and reward in Just about every setting.

Gameplay Innovation and Challenge
Setting up upon the effective to start with-particular person adventure framework of its predecessor, Echoes retains the immersive exploration and scanning mechanics that lovers cherished, though incorporating new weapons, suit upgrades, and puzzles. However, the most important evolution originates from its issue and complexity.

Echoes is known for its steep problem, both in battle and environmental puzzles. Enemies strike more difficult, help you save points are scarcer, and the sport requires keen observation and timing. New additions like the Light Beam and Darkish Beam not only boost beat selection SODO but also are important for solving puzzles and unlocking doors in the corresponding realm. The intelligent interaction in between weapons and environments adds depth to your typical Metroidvania formulation.

Boss battles are A different emphasize, offering multi-stage encounters that examination both equally reflexes and strategic thinking. The introduction from the villainous Ing — shadowy beings from Darkish Aether — supplies a menacing and thematically reliable enemy drive. These creatures, together with the recurring danger of Dim Samus, increase to the sport’s oppressive ambiance.

Ambiance and Worldbuilding
From its moody soundtrack to its alien architecture, Metroid Key two: Echoes is steeped in ambiance. The sport’s artwork route paints Aether being a earth of stark contrasts — serene and mystical in Gentle Aether, desolate and foreboding in its darkish counterpart. This visual storytelling is complemented with the sequence’ trademark use of scanning, enabling players to piece with each other lore organically and uncover the tragic history of the Luminoth, Aether’s indigenous inhabitants.
